The Grand Tour

TouchPad

The TouchPad pointing device is located in the

center of the palm rest and is used to control the

on-screen pointer. Refer to the

Using the Touch

Pad

section in Chapter 4,

Operating Basics

.

TouchPad Control

Buttons

Control buttons below the TouchPad let you

select menu items or manipulate text and

graphics designated by the on-screen pointer.

Left and Right

Speakers

The computer provides two speakers for stereo

sound reproduction.

Power Button

Press the power button to turn the computer’s

power on and off. There is an LED inside the

power button (depending on the model you

purchased) which shines either green or blue

(depending on the model you purchased) when

the system is on.

Internet Button

Press the Internet button to open your default

web brower.
The button setting can be changed in TOSHIBA

Controls properties. To access the TOSHIBA

Controls properties, click start, click the Control

Panel, click Printers and Other Hardware and

select the TOSHIBA Controls icon.
(The availability of this function depends on the

model you purchased.)

CD/DVD Button

Pressing this button when the computer’s power

is off will run Express Media Player. Once

Express Media Player is launched, the power

indicator turns on, the audio control buttons are

enabled and pressing this button again will do

nothing. If you press this button while the

computer is switched on or switched off into

Standby Mode, it will launch either Windows
Media

®

Player or WinDVD depending on the

media that is loaded.
The button setting can be changed in TOSHIBA

Controls properties. To access the TOSHIBA

Controls properties, click start, click the Control

Panel, click Printers and Other Hardware and

select the TOSHIBA Controls icon.
(The availability of this function depends on the

model you purchased.)

When you use Express Media Player, please assign the CD/DVD button to

“CD/DVD” in TOSHIBA Controls Properties.
